JUNE 12 ,1993 Presidential election : NRC ( TOFA ) Vs SDP (ABIOLA)

Today is the 19th year anniversary of that historical election . Here we  bring to you the entire results , from NRC/SDP presidential primaries to general election results - state by state.

Flashback on Nigeria's aborted third Republic:
...while NRC held their Presidential primary on March 27 1993 in the Port Harcourt-Rivers State at the Civic center , SDP held theirs in Jos- Plateau State, at the Stadium .

It is of note that none of the Political Parties was able to produced a clear winner in the first ballot .below are the results:

NRC:

A. First Ballot;

Alhaji Bashir Tofa................4,472 votes.

Dr. Joe Nwodo...................1,813 votes.

Chief Pere Ajuwa...............1,404 votes.

SDP:

Chief M.K.O. Abiola...........3,617 votes.

Amb. Baba Gana Kingibe.....3,225 votes.

Alhaji Atiku Abubakar.......2,066 votes.

B. Second Ballot;

NRC:

Alhaji Bashir Tofa............4,281 votes.

Chief Pere Ajuwa.........575 votes.

Dr. Joe Nwodo..............99 votes.

SDP:

Chief M.K.O. Abiola ........2,683 votes.

Amb. Baba Gana Kingibe....2,456 votes.

( Alhaji Atiku Abubakar had stepped down after the first ballot).

Alhaji Bashir Tofa was declared the Presidential candidate of NRC ,

while Chief M.K.O. Abiola was declared the Presidential candidate of SDP for the June 12, 1993 Presidential election.

The General election:

. Still on flashback of Nigerian aborted third Republic.
The result of the Presidential election of June 12 1993 ...Abiola(SDP) Vs Tofa (NRC)

STATE. Registered voters.                       NRC.       SDP.              Total
1- Abia State:
Total Registered voters =991,569.
NRC votes= 151,227 (58.96%)

SDP votes =105,273 (41.04%).

Total votes cast= 256,500.




2- Adamawa State:

Total Registered voters =954,680.

NRC votes=163,921(52.92%)

SDP votes =147,000(47.28%).

Total votes cast =310,921


3- Akwa Ibom State:

Total Registered voters =1,032,995.

NRC votes =199,342(48.14%).

SDP= 214,787(51.86%).

Total votes cast= 414,202


4- Anambra State:

Total Registered voters =1,248,226

NRC votes = 159,256(42.89%).

SDP votes = 212,024(57.11)


Total votes cast= 371,282


5- Bauchi State :

Total Registered voters=
2,048,627

 NRC votes =513,077 (60.56%)

SDP votes =334,197(39.44%)

Total votes cast =847,274


6- Benue State :

Total Registered Voters =1,297,072.

NRC votes =186,302(43.0%).

SDP votes =246,830(57.0%).

Total votes cast =433,132


7- Borno State:

Total Registered votes= 1,222,533

NRC votes= 128,684(45.68%).

SDP votes =153,495 (54.4%).

Total votes cast=282,179


8- Cross River State:

Total Registered votes=876,599

NRC votes=148,079(44.62%)

SDP votes =183,803(55.38%).

Total votes cast= 331,882


9- Delta State:

Total Registered voters =1,155,182.

NRC votes= 145,001(30.7%).

SDP votes = 327,278(69.3%).

Total votes cast = 472,278


10- Edo State:

Total Registered voters =
 912,680.
NRC votes =103,572(3.0%).

SDP votes = 205,407(66.0%).

Total votes cast= 308,979

11- Enugu State :

Total Registered voters =1,291,750

NRC votes =233,281((54.60%).

SDP votes =193,969 (45.40%)

Total votes cast =427,250


12- Imo State:

Total Registered voters =1,141,630

NRC votes =193,202(55.22%)

SDP votes =156,700(44.78%).

Total votes cast= 349,902


13- Jigawa State :

Total Registered voters = 1,230,215.

NRC votes =89,836(39.3%).

SDP votes =138,552.(60.7%)

Total votes cast= 228,388


14- Kaduna State :

Total Registered voters = 1,614,258.

NRC votes = 336,860

SDP votes= 389,713.

Total votes cast= 726,573


15- Kano State :

Total votes cast =2,583,057

NRC votes= 154,809(48%).

SDP votes = 169,619(52%)

Total votes cast= 324,428


16- Katsina State:

Total Registered voters = 1,661,132.

NRC votes =271,077(61.30%).

SDP votes =171,169(38.70%).

Total votes cast: 442,246


17- Kebbi State:

Total Registered voters =824,254.

NRC votes =174,609(71.32%)

SDP votes =70,209(28.68%).

Total votes cast=244,817



18- Kogi State :

Total Registered voters= 978,019

NRC votes=265,732(54.4%)

SDP votes= 222,760( 45.6%).

Total votes cast.=488,492


19- Kwara State :

Total Registered Voters =669,625.

NRC votes =80,209(22.76%)

SDP votes :272,270(77.24%).

Total votes cast=352,479


20- Lagos State :

Total Registered voters =2,395,421

NRC votes= 149,432(14.46%)

SDP votes= 883,965(83.54%).

Total votes cast= 1,033,970



21- Niger State:

Total Registered voters =1,002,173.

NRC votes= 221,437(62%).

SDP votes= 136,350(38.0%).

Total votes cast=357,787


22- Ogun state :

Total Registered voters =941,889.

NRC votes =59,246(12.19%)

SDP votes =426,725(83.53%)

Total votes cast=


23- Ondo State :

Total Registered voters =1,767,896.

NRC votes= 160,994(16.5%)

SDP votes = 803,024(83.30%).

Total votes cast = 964,018



24- Osun State:

Total Registered votes= 1,056,690.

NRC votes= 72,068(16.5%)

SDP votes= 365,266(83.52%)

Total votes cast= 437,334


25- Oyo state:

Total Registered voters =1,579,280

NRC votes= 105,788(16.48%).

SDP votes= 536,011(83.52%).

Total votes cast=641,799


26- Plateau State:

Total Registered voters =1,513,186.

NRC votes =259,394(38.3%).

SDP votes =417,565(61.7%)

Total votes cast= 676,959


27- Rivers State  :

Total Registered voters=1,908,878.

NRC votes =646,952(63.01%)

SDP votes=  379,565(36.99%).

Total votes cast= 1,026,824



28- Sokoto State:

Total Registered voters =1,636,119

NRC votes =372,260(79.21%)

 SDP votes= 97,726 (20.79%)

Total votes cast=469,986


29- Taraba State :

Total Registered voters =769,912.

NRC votes =188,937(47.30%)

SDP votes =210,839(52.70%).

Total votes cast=399,776


30- Yobe State:

Total Registered Voters= 665,299.

NRC votes =65,133(37%)

SDP votes =110,921(63.0%).

Total votes cast= 176,054



31- Federal Capital Territory-FCT,Abuja:
Total Registered voters =152,686.

NRC votes =18,313(47.84%).


SPD votes = 19,968(52.16%).

Total votes cast=38,281

..............................
The election was annulled by the military President Ibrahim Babangida even when it was adjudged as the must free and fair election in Nigeria as at then.
